Game of Thrones: The Best On-Screen Couples So Far

After last night's much-anticipated premiere of Game of Thrones Season 7, (don’t worry, no spoilers here), OurWedding revisits its favourite GoT on-screen couples since the series commenced.


7.Robb Stark & Talisa

Not the best place to start considering that Robb Starks’s love for Talisa was the cause of one of the most horrific scenes in the series. Had Robb Stark not fallen head over heels for the nurse and honoured his oath to marry Walder Frey’s granddaughter, Robb and his family would have stood a chance to live and the Red Wedding would have never happened.

6.Ned & Catelyn Stark

They only lasted a season as a couple, but what a couple they were. Ned and Catelyn Stark were possibly the only happily married couple in the Seven Kingdoms, despite the constant prick in Catelyn’s side that is Jon Snow, i.e., Ned’s bastard son.

5.Samwell Tarly & Gilly

As a Man of the Night’s Watch, Sam is forbidden from lusting over Gilly, but these two make an adorable couple despite them not really being a couple. Gilly teaches Sam about life while Sam impresses Gilly with his knowledge and worldliness, and we can’t overlook how noble Sam has been for caring for and protecting Gilly, and for saving her and her child from the White Walkers.

4.Grey Worm & Missandei

There’s something remarkable about these two, especially since Grey Worm is teetering in forbidden territory. The two shared their first kiss in season 5, which sparked a flurry of questions, not least because Grey Worm is an Unsullied, and has been conditioned from a young age to not feel empathy, fear or any feelings whatsoever, sexual or otherwise. His physical limitations have enabled them to connect on a much deeper level though – in fact, Nathalie Emmanuel, who plays Missandei, said their relationship “is a lovely beacon of sweetness and purity, in a way, in such a corrupt, violent world.

3.Jon Snow & Ygritte

Jon Snow has captured many a viewer’s heart, but this onscreen couple – and offscreen too! – are simply the best pairing. He is an honest man, a “pretty” one too, and devoted to his cause, while she is wild, unpredictable and rough around the edges. Jon Snow, undercover in the army of wildlings, fell for her, and what ensued was a brief but intense affair, which could be condensed into that one night in the cave. Although it ended with three arrows in the back for Jon Snow, nobody could downplay the downright cuteness, and hotness, of this couple.

2.Daenerys Targaryen & Khal Drogo

Right, so Daenerys was sold to the brutish leader of a thug tribe, and her first encounter with Khal Drogo could only be described as rape. But in typical Daenerys fashion, she turned a disadvantage into an advantage. This couple turned out to be one of the strongest on the show, despite Khal being killed off in season 1. Turns out the strongman is something of a softy, and even tried learning common tongue so he could communicate with his wife. And despite a string of love interests since his death, none of them are quite her Sun and Stars.

1.Brienne of Tarth & Tormund Giantsbane

“When there’s so much darkness, if you give a piece of light, they grab it with both hands,” said Kristofer Hivju, the real-life Tormund, about his character’s budding relationship with Brienne. And that is exactly what their relationship is – a beacon of light, and a touch of comic relief, to an otherwise dark and dreary world. Nobody expected the possible pairing of these two, and – between both of them being pretty masculine – there are no stereotypical gender roles in this couple, which is refreshing in the male-dominated world of Westeros.
